Survey of Conversion Support Software,

Abstract

This survey of conversion support software was compiled to be used by the Federal COBOL Compiler Testing Service in its implementation of a Federal Conversion Support Center. It includes items which deal with portability as well as conversion, reflecting the compiler's belief that problem avoidance (developing portable software) is at least as important as problem solution (conversion), and that the two issues are closely related. Ergo the inclusion of programming aids such as higher-level language processors. No attempt has been made to date to evaluate each of these software tools -- such an evaluation is best performed by the organization planning the use of these tools. Where available, a mailing address for a given company or source is included. (Author)
